Drilling Fluid Function, Varieties and Significance

Bore mud plays a critical part in the procedure of boring boreholes . Its chief duties include lifting rock fragments from the lower of the hole , reducing the temperature of the cutting tool , lubricating the rotating column, and upholding the shaft integrity . Various sorts of drilling fluid exist , ranging from water to oil-based and artificial mixtures, some designed for certain geological conditions . The correct selection and management of well slurry is absolutely required for a secure and efficient drilling campaign.

The Chemistry of Drilling Fluid: A Deep Dive

Drilling mud, essential for efficient and safe oil and gas extraction, presents check here a fascinating area of chemical study. Its complex structure goes far beyond simple liquid; it’s a carefully designed mixture of solids, polymers, and primary liquids. The chief role involves suspending cuttings, reducing friction, and regulating formation stress, all reliant on precise chemical properties. Various types of bentonite contribute to thickness, while polymer molecules provide seepage control. Furthermore, the alkalinity dictates durability and influences the behavior of dispersants, and prevention of shale instability demands a nuanced understanding of their processes.
